SR 193 Original	2018 Regular Session	Bishop
Requests the Louisiana State Police, the sheriff of each parish, each chief of police, each district
attorney, and the attorney general ensure that when any person arrested or detained in connection
with the investigation or commission of any criminal offense is being interrogated, interviewed, or
otherwise questioned by a law enforcement officer or district attorney, any reference made by the
person to an "attorney", "lawyer", "counsel", or substantially similar term, shall be deemed an
invocation of the right to assistance of counsel, and the interrogation, interview, or other questioning
shall cease until such time as the person obtains counsel or counsel is appointed for the person.
